What Food Is Cromer Famous For?

Cromer is a fishing town on the north coast of Norfolk, England. It is a popular tourist destination, renowned for its pier, sandy beaches, and stunning scenery. But what food is Cromer famous for?

Cromer is most well known for its delicious seafood. The town’s pier acts as a hub of activity as boats come in and out with their daily catch.

This means that the town has access to some of the freshest seafood in the region. Cromer crab is especially famous, with native brown crabs being caught off the pier and sold fresh to restaurants around the area.

This fresh seafood forms the basis of many dishes served in local pubs and restaurants. From fish and chips to crab sandwiches, Cromer has something to tantalise every taste bud. Cromer also boasts some excellent fishmongers where local specialties like herring can be bought to take home.
